In all honesty this anime is by no means TERRIBLE. The story was awful and the music was 80's awful. But it's Mario, so it gains a few points in key departments!
-------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------
Story: While the story was terrible, it remained true to the Mario standards of "save Princess Peach, then we're done!" It also managed to include the power-ups we all remember, such as the Red Mushroom, Fire Flower, and the Star! So it definitely tries hard to please we who played the games. It's very comedic as well, and I actually managed to chuckle a few times. A few scenes were extremely boring, having only

Art: The art isn't half bad! All of the Mario baddies we all know and love were involved, and they looked very good! Hammer Bro ftw! :D It does indeed shine in a few areas. The only drawback is that it's only (to the best of my knowledge) available in VHS form. So it's not exactly perfect viewing. Of course this isn't the fault of the artists!
Sound: The SFX were awesome, the only reason sound scored an 8 in my review, as the music was awful. The random "Denim, denim, denim" or the warp tube sounds were extremely nostalgic, and they honestly kept me watching it. You could also hear other familiar sounds that come from the Mario NES series of games! The music was terrible though, so there's your fair warning.
Character: It's Mario, so naturally it's good. But the lack of originality stopped me from giving it a higher rating.
Enjoyment: Besides the random fun SFX and the nostalgic sight of Koopas, Hammer Bro, and Bowser this really isn't too exciting to watch. Without the nostalgia I really doubt this would have gotten any bit of enjoyment out of me. IF you enjoy Mario you'll definitely find some satisfaction SOMEWHERE.
To sum it up, you may as well watch it! If you're a Mario fan you'll definitely have a laugh or two or maybe a "W00T!" during the final battle. From someone who doesn't look back to the NES Mario days as the best of their lives, however... You should probably pass this one up. :D
